The parts content information on a window sticker shows the percentage of vehicle components sourced from specific countries, important for consumers interested in the origin of their vehicle's parts.
Market value is generally estimated based on the 2012 SUBARU vehicle’s history, condition, and comparable sales, helping to provide a guideline for buyers and sellers, though specific values can vary.
Keeping your vehicle for about three to five years can optimize its resale value, balancing depreciation with usage and maintenance costs.
Our reports may provide information on any open recalls affecting the 2012 SUBARU OUTBACK, detailing the nature of the recall and recommended actions, if such records exist.
Safety ratings on the Monroney label include crash test results from agencies like the NHTSA and IIHS, providing an assessment of the vehicle's safety.
While not necessary, decoding a VIN for a routine service appointment can provide the mechanic with precise model information, facilitating accurate service and parts replacement.
Yes, a VIN decoder can often determine if specific safety technologies are equipped on a 2012 SUBARU OUTBACK based on the trim and optional equipment codes within the VIN.
Advanced safety features can influence the resale value and slow the depreciation of vehicles by making them more attractive to safety-conscious buyers.
Ownership history, including the number of previous owners and how long they owned the vehicle, can indicate how well the 2012 SUBARU vehicle was maintained, if such records are available.
